Restoring fast disk takeover

If PowerHA® SystemMirror® has placed a volume group in the passive-only state and the volume group has then been varied off manually, fast disk takeover has effectively been disabled for that volume group. A fallover of the owning resource group to this node will be forced to use normal disk takeover, which will require additional time.

A volume group can be varied off incorrectly as a result of manual cleanup of resources or any other time when an administrator is manually varying off volume groups.

Restore the fast disk takeover capability for a volume group on a given node by using one of the following methods:

  • Stopping and restarting cluster services on the node
  • Moving the owning resource group to the node. The owning resource group can then be moved back to its original location, if desired.
  • Manually vary on the volume group in passive mode with the command:
    varyonvg -n -C -P <volume group name>

These methods will restore the volume group to a state where fast disk takeover is again available for the given node.
